ARM9裸跑
文章平均质量分 79
zhongyajie
这个作者很懒,什么都没留下…
展开
-
2440test中按键的分析(EnterCritical ExitCritical)
这里分析了4个按键,还有 ENIT8 和 EINT19没有,不过原理一样的。 4个按键,分别是 EINT11 / GPG3 EINT13 / GPG5 EINT14 / GPG6 EINT15 / GPG7 外部上拉电阻。 EINT 8-23 共用一个IRQ向量。 初始化步骤 1,设置IO的功能,00 输入 01输出 02 第二功能 P292 设置的方法是 rGPGC转载 2012-01-31 16:56:04 · 537 阅读 · 0 评论 -
详细分析优龙BIOS代码
今天,我不求助——详细分析优龙BIOS代码(ADS编写) 看了一段时间BIOS。从周立功BSP下的eboot到优龙的BIOS,问过不少弱智问题(通常是我自己没有找到就说XXX很奇怪就来问),幸好有eeworld前辈指点,我才慢慢积累经验。优龙的BIOS我已经了解大概,在功成身退之时拿出来分享,免得以后有人走弯路。 ============== 首先是汇编部分2440init.s,因为第一个运转载 2012-02-27 19:57:41 · 986 阅读 · 0 评论 -
ARM920T的MMU与Cache
ARM920T的MMU与Cache 2008-08-28 09:43:15| 分类: MMU | 标签: |字号大中小 订阅 ARM920T的MMU与Cache Cache是高性能CPU解决总线访问速度瓶颈的方法,然而它的使用却是需要权衡的,因为缓存本身的动作,如块拷贝和替换等,也是很消耗CPU时间的。MMU的重要性勿庸置疑,ARM920转载 2012-02-27 20:21:33 · 681 阅读 · 0 评论